> I am trying to generate the signature with HmacSHA256 algorithm for SQS
> request authentication.
> I have used the code used in the developer guide as it is.
>
> In developer guide, HMAC-SHA1 signature is used.
> But in SQS SDK client, HmacSHA256 is used.
>
> I have used the following code to calculate signature. But calculated
> signature is different from the sqs client request.
>
>            private static final String HMAC_SHA1_ALGORITHM = "HmacSHA256";
>            // get an hmac_sha1 key from the raw key bytes
>             SecretKeySpec signingKey = new SecretKeySpec(key.getBytes(),
> HMAC_SHA1_ALGORITHM);
>             // get an hmac_sha1 Mac instance and initialize with the
> signing key
>             Mac mac = Mac.getInstance(HMAC_SHA1_ALGORITHM);
>             mac.init(signingKey);
>             // compute the hmac on input data bytes
>             byte[] rawHmac = mac.doFinal(data.getBytes());
>             // base64-encode the hmac
>             result = Base64Utils.encode(rawHmac);
>
> Is there anything wrong with above signature calculating code(this is same
> as in developer guide except algorithm) ?
